Output 88473912369f511ad3615b220a293f69c95eec50c23cf3ece3c21786fd4a9af6:17

value
2914166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40553bcc5c83b4ebbc9ce26d38e44c51e7413ba OP_EQUAL
address
3J6swCw9wpi3gnnVRNyzZyAAB2M39nqhyh
transaction
88473912369f511ad3615b220a293f69c95eec50c23cf3ece3c21786fd4a9af6
spent
true